ZIP Code 13214 is a ZIP Code Tabulation Area in Onondaga County, New York, home to about 8,713 residents. At $93,200, its median household income sits above Onondaga County's $74,740.
From 2019 to 2023, ZIP Code 13214's population grew 3.2% from 8,439 to 8,713, while its median gross rent rose 17.4% from $850 to $998.
White (non-Hispanic) residents are the largest group, 66.8% of the population. 69.3% of workers drive to work alone.
